Chuksanhang Port is a Korean East Sea fishing port in Yeongdeok area — one of Korea's most photogenic fishing ports, with the iconic 'Blue Road' coastal walk extending from the port through nearby coastal cliffs. The port combines working harbor activity with strong scenic photo destinations. For travelers driving Yeongdeok's coast and wanting a working-port + scenic-walk combination, Chuksanhang is one of the cleaner specialty single picks.
